New Every Morning

Commentators highlight the phrase "This day." Citing ancient Jewish scholars, they explain it's not just about the specific day Moses spoke, but an encouragement to view God's commands as fresh and relevant every single day. It's a call to daily renewal in our commitment to God, as if we were receiving His word for the first time.
